Benzodiazepines (benzos) are a type of prescription sedative often used for their calming effect. These medications are essential to those who face debilitating anxiety and panic disorders. Doctors may prescribe them for the treatment of muscle spasms, insomnia, and seizures as well. Yet, benzos are also very addictive.

What Are Benzos and Why Are They Addictive?
Benzos include tranquilizers, either sedatives or anxiolytics. They work as a central nervous system depressant. That means they slow down the function of the brain. That makes them highly effective for the treatment of racing thoughts and seizures. Some of the most common brands include:
- Valium®
- Xanax®
- Restoril®
- Ativan®
- Klonopin®
Being taken under a doctor’s watch reduces the risk of addiction forming. However, even in those where the medication does work well, it is possible to become dependent. That means your doctor may switch you off these drugs for others.

Diagnosis of Benzo Addiction
To be medically diagnosed with a sedative use disorder, a person must suffer from 2 of 11 potential symptoms within the same 12-month period. Some of those symptoms include:
- Increasing the amount of use of the sedative to reach the same level of support or treatment
- The development of withdrawal effects when the drug is not present in a person’s system
- Spending a significant amount of the day’s effort trying to get the drug, using it, or recovering from the use of it
- Impairment of performance at home, work, or school when the drug is not present
- Intense cravings and the need to seek the drug consistently
- Taking the drug more often or for a longer period of time than recommended by the prescribing doctor
- Previous overdoses from the use of the drug

Detox May Be Necessary
Benzo misuse can lead to intense withdrawal symptoms. These can be dangerous if a person simply stops taking the substance without winding down their use.
